Method
Soup
- 1
Prepare the Soup
In a large pot, combine the chicken broth, diced carrots, diced celery, diced onion, and minced garlic. Bring to a boil over medium-high heat.
- 2
Season the Soup
Once boiling, reduce the heat to low and add salt and black pepper. Let it simmer for about 20 minutes, or until the vegetables are tender.
- 3
Finish the Soup
Stir in the chopped parsley just before serving. Adjust seasoning to taste.
Rice
- 4
Cook the Rice
In a medium saucepan, combine white rice, water, and salt. Bring to a boil over medium-high heat.
- 5
Simmer the Rice
Once boiling, reduce the heat to low, cover, and simmer for about 18 minutes, or until the rice is tender and water is absorbed.
- 6
Fluff the Rice
Remove from heat and let it sit covered for 5 minutes. Fluff with a fork before serving.
Entrée
- 7
Prepare the Chicken Strips
In a bowl, season the chicken strips with salt and black pepper. Set aside.
- 8
Set Up Breading Station
In a shallow bowl, place flour. In another bowl, beat the egg. In a third bowl, place bread crumbs.
- 9
Bread the Chicken Strips
Coat each chicken strip in flour, dip it into the beaten egg, then coat it with bread crumbs. Repeat for all chicken strips.
- 10
Fry the Chicken Strips
In a large skillet, heat oil over medium-high heat. Once hot, fry the chicken strips in batches until golden brown, about 4-5 minutes per side.
- 11
Prepare the Spring Roll
Heat the spring roll according to package instructions, or fry until golden and crispy.
